Author Biography: Sharon K. Koss

Sharon K. Koss, SPHR, CCP is the president of Koss Management Consulting and a member of the Society for Human Resource Management. She lives in Seattle.

Book Synopsis

Whether creating a new system or filling in the gaps in an established business, this resource acts as a practical tool for dealing with compensation in the workplace. Linking pay and performance, this guidebook demonstrates how to improve a salary administration program and includes facts sheets, templates, and sample forms that can be customized to meet each organization's unique requirements.
